MBT Supervisor
Salary: £42,307.20 per annum
Shift Pattern: 4on-4off rotating shift pattern (4 days 06:00-18:00, 4 off & 4 nights 18:00-06:00)
Key Responsibilities:
- Safely managing of all operational resource to maximise plant performance, whilst maintaining a safe work environment at all times.
- Ensuring productivity and availability exceeds minimum defined standards in the Refinement area.
- Ensuring Environmental compliance within the sites permitted activities.
- Scheduling pest control treatments and managing stock levels.
- Implementing best practice and continuous improvement in cost control/process operations.
- Controlling the material movements out of the plant,
- Providing records of all plant operations, settings and stoppages, and to attribute causes to all unplanned downtime.
- Carrying out regular stock and inventory of all materials.
- Keeping abreast of changes to company standards and legislation.
- Implementing and ensuring compliance standards.
- Analyse and review maintenance activities, cost control, health and safety and service KPIs, implementing necessary corrective actions in the event of variance.
- Schedule planned preventative maintenance, inspections and cleaning in order to minimise downtime
- Maintain a high level of housekeeping in all areas.
- Lead and participate in CI improvement projects.

What We Do
Founded in 1912, Biffa is a leading UK-based integrated waste management company providing collection, treatment, recycling, and energy generation services. Serving commercial, industrial, and public sector clients, Biffa promotes sustainable waste management solutions and a circular economy. The company employs over 10,000 people and is committed to achieving net-zero emissions by 2050 through investment in green infrastructure and innovative waste-to-energy technologies.
